“What makes photography a strange invention is that its primary raw materials are time and light.”   – John Berger

A group of young people aged 10 to 18 from South East London embark on a journey through time and light, guided by themes of connection and reflection. 

Along the way, they explore their surroundings, their histories, and themselves – uncovering hidden layers of identity and expressing what it means to belong.

Through photography, they capture moments both personal and shared. This exhibition invites you to see through their eyes and step into their stories, while offering space to reflect on your own connection to community and self.

eye4change is an award winning photography charity committed to providing a means of connection and community, for disadvantaged people of all ages, particularly young people. 

Harnessing the power of photography, to improve confidencecommunicationwellbeing and a sense of belonging.
